Hi all !
I've got 13 lb of misc PC RAM sticks. Been busy for a while to depopulate them; first with a chisel to remove the MMLC, and then remove the chips.
But as 13 lb is a heck of a lot ram sticks, I was hoping and wondering if it has been done before to remove the MMLC and the chips with hot hcl, and if it's any good or not..
I have been scrapping for the last 5-6 months, breaking each component down to collect what I need but hundreds of these ram sticks are a pain to do at a rate of like 15-20 pcs per hour..
So the idea was to use AP from a previous batch, and bring it to a simmer and wait till it all falls off. Then with a pair of tweezers take the chips out, and collect the MMLC by dropping it in a filter.
I do not realy want to boil it, just make the HCL hot enough to eat the legs of the chips.
Does this give issues with the MMLC to process them later for the Pd / Pt ? Can I just rinse the MMLC and process later, or do I have to process them right away as they are taken out of hot HCL ?
I know monolithics have to be boiled in clean HCL to start the recovery process, but I was hoping that AP would leave them intact so I can recover the pt/pd later.
Any experience or idea's on that ?
